Also, there's three factions in the game; joining any of these (or none) significantly affects the game and its outcome. You can also choose to side with the bad guy(s) should you wish. I also feel that the game's setting, a mixture of high-fantasy and sci-fi, is something worth mentioning, because I feel it's very inventive and unique. |
